Beyond Numbers: The Soft Skills Every Chartered Accountant Should Possess

This blog explores the non-technical skills of exceptional Chartered Accountants (CAs) in the finance and business world, highlighting how to evaluate these qualities when choosing an accountant for a business.


⦁ A skilled chartered accountant should possess effective communication, problem-solving aptitude, ethical considerations, adaptability, and client relationship management skills.


⦁ They should be able to translate complex financial jargon into comprehensible language, actively listen, and foster transparency and trust.


⦁ They should also be strategic problem solvers, seeking innovative solutions to address financial challenges.


⦁ They should adhere to the highest ethical standards, ensuring confidentiality and privacy of clients’ financial information.


⦁ They should be open to embracing new technologies and industry trends and maintain strong client relationships, prioritizing client satisfaction, timely communication, and a proactive approach.


Evaluating Soft Skills When Choosing an Accountant: When selecting a chartered accountant for your business, consider incorporating an assessment of soft skills into your criteria:


⦁ Assess the candidate’s ability to articulate complex concepts clearly and concisely.


⦁ Present hypothetical scenarios to gauge their problem-solving approach and creativity.


⦁ Discuss ethical considerations and ask for examples from their professional experience that highlight their commitment to ethical conduct.


⦁ Inquire about instances where they had to adapt to changing circumstances in their career.


⦁ Seek client testimonials or references to gauge their reputation for effective communication and client relationship management.


Conclusion: Chartered accountants possess essential soft skills such as effective communication, problem-solving, ethical considerations, adaptability, and client relationship management, which elevate them from financial advisors to trusted partners in the finance industry.
